iPhone hit 1112 possibly headed for WiiWare

If they can squeeze it in

Product: 1112, Episode 1 | Developer: Agharta Studio | Genre: Adventure
When 1112 was released on the iPhone last month it was like a (touchscreen activated) breath of fresh air. Ostensibly an adventure game, Agharta Studio's oddball masterpiece took delight in making you carry out a host of mundane tasks on behalf of chief protagonist Louis Everett.

Now developer Alexandre Leboucher has revealed that he has received a preliminary approach about porting the game to Nintendo's ever-popular Wii console. He feels that the controls would port well to the console's motion-sensitive remotes, but there is one major drawback.

The sticking point appears to relate to size - at present WiiWare titles are limited to just 42 megabytes of storage, which is about a third of the space the original iPhone game required.

So, not only is a game set to be ported from a fledgling handheld device to Nintendo's behemoth, but it'll actually have to be downscaled in the process. What a world.

Still, if the developers can overcome that not insignificant hitch we could see it flying off the digital shelves.
